Ultimately, the 2019 release stands as a landmark in heavy music. It is a dense, multilayered journey through pain and catharsis. By looking inward and embracing their most experimental instincts, Slipknot created a record that felt both nostalgic for their Iowa-era intensity and bold enough to chart a new path for the future of metal. Five years later, its impact remains undisputed, cementing its place as a modern classic in the discography of one of the world's most influential bands.

The title says it all. A meditation on mortality and the feeling of being a ghost in your own life. The song builds from a clean, resigned verse into a colossal, screaming climax. The final minute features the band playing a single, repeating chord while Taylor wails "Killed, Killed, Killed..." It is exhausting in the best way.
